legalistic Pharisee

This phrase is thrown around a lot to justify ignoring the scriptures.

It’s totally unbiblical.

There is not one instance in the Bible where the Pharisees are rebuked for being “legalistic”.

Their problem was with being HYPOCRITICAL.

Let’s get out of our church echo chambers and start reading our Bibles like a child again…

“…do not sound a trumpet before thee, as the hypocrites do in the synagogues...” (Matthew 6:2, KJV)

“…be not, as the hypocrites...” (Matthew 6:16, KJV)

“But woe unto you, scribes and Pharisees, hypocrites!” (Matthew 23:13, KJV)

How did the word “hypocrite” get replaced by “legalist”?

Here’s how:

“But in vain they do worship me, teaching for doctrines the commandments of men.” (Matthew 15:9, KJV)
